David Gilhooly
United States, 1943 – 2013
Place of BirthAuburn, California, United States
BiographyDavid Gilhooly began his artistic career as a studio assistant for Robert Arneson in the early 1960s. By the 1970s, he had gained national attention for his often irreverent and wild ceramics. Gilhooly gave up the use of ceramics in the mid 1980s, in favor of Plexiglas, synthetics, and found objects. In addition to making his quirky, pop culture-inspired works, he has taught at several colleges and universities. Education: B.A., University of California, Davis, 1965; M.A., University of California, Davis, 1967
